螺旋星系的更多卫星星系

摘要

我们呈现了一套与银河系相似 luminosity 的孤立螺旋星系的卫星星系修订并扩展的目录。该样本包含 115 个卫星星系,其中 69 个是在我们多光纤红移调查中发现的。用于进一步探讨来自原始样本(Zaritsky 等 1993)的结果。卫星星系按定义位于投影分离 <~ 500 kpc,与其关联的 primary 星系的绝对遥远速度差小于 500 km/s 且至少暗淡 2.2 星等。该调查的一个关键特征是这些系统的严格孤立性,这简化了任何动力学分析。我们发现没有证据表明卫星系统的速度分散随半径增加而减小,直至银心距为 400 kpc,这表明光柱延伸至 200 kpc 之外。 Furthermore, the new sample affirms our previous conclusions (Zaritsky et al. 1993) that (1) the velocity difference between a satellite and its primary is not strongly correlated with the rotation speed of the primary, (2) the system of satellites has a slight net rotation (34 \pm 14 km/s) in the same sense as the primary's disk, and (3) that the halo mass of an ~ L* spiral galaxy is in excess of 2 x 10^{12} solar masses.
